Pixie Lott to perform in support of the 2012 Paralympic Games

Pixie Lott will perform at a special event next weekend to both support and raise awareness for the upcoming Paralympic Games. 

The 'All About Tonight' beauty will sing at Sainsbury's Super Saturday, which will take place at Clapham Common on September 10, with other top performers such as The Saturdays, Sugababes and The Wanted. 

Speaking to the Daily Star newspaper during her guest editor spot, Lott said:

"Next weekend I’m performing at the Sainsbury’s Super Saturday event to raise awareness of the Paralympic games before next year’s Olympics. On my way to school in London I used to get the train through Stratford, which is where the Olympic village is. I can’t believe it’s come round so quickly."

She also opened up about her excitement at the 2012 London Olympics and revealed that she used to be a gymnast:

"Gymnastics is something I used to do myself but one of the girls doing it with me was horrible so I left. I like to do stretches when I can but I’m not going to do a workout DVD."
